WebThe control group participated in three standardized attention training sessions: Attention Process Training (APT) (Sohlberg Mateer, 2001). The experimental group participated in three Neurologic Music Therapy (Thaut Hoemberg, 2014) sessions using a standardized intervention: Music Attention Control Training (MACT).
